Myfab invites you to a new program, offering FREE access to our cleanroom nanotechnology facilities. The aim is to give new user groups practical experience of Myfab. Interested users should present a project proposal. The call will open on 6 November 2012, and will run until all financial grants have been distributed. Applicants must hold a position at a Swedish university/institute or SME, and should not have any previous experience of micro-nanofabrication at Myfab.

Ångström Microstructure Laboratory

The Uppsala University seal made in dry etched silicon. The etch depth is 15 micrometer.

The Ångström Microstructure Laboratory provides a unique resource for R&D in the micro- & nanotechnology field. A powerful combination of process and analysis laboratories makes the entire sequence from realization to evaluation available under one roof. We provide an open user facility for university and industry personnel active in research or development.

The MSL staff is responsible for the lab operation, such as:

- cleanroom infrastructure
- equipment maintenance
- user education, training and support
- development and control of processes and methods
- commissions for internal and external customers

MSL is a state-of-the-art laboratory and a competent organization that provide a link between university research and industrial development.
